The State of Master Bantu is a gargantuan, efficient nation, renowned for its compulsory military service, complete lack of public education, and complete absence of social welfare. The hard-nosed, hard-working, cynical population of 22.489 billion Master Bantuans are ruled with an iron fist by the corrupt, dictatorship government, which oppresses anyone who isn't on the board of a Fortune 500 company. Large corporations tend to be above the law, and use their financial clout to gain ever-increasing government benefits at the expense of the poor and unemployed.

The medium-sized, moralistic, pro-business, well-organized government is dominated by the Department of Law & Order, with Industry and Defense also on the agenda, while Welfare and Spirituality aren't funded at all. Citizens pay a flat income tax of 16.1%.

The thriving Master Bantuan economy, worth 630 trillion betales a year, is highly specialized and led by the Gambling industry, with major contributions from Arms Manufacturing, Furniture Restoration, and Trout Farming. Average income is 28,021 betales, but there is a significant disparity between incomes, with the richest 10% of citizens earning 85,600 per year while the poor average 7,109, a ratio of 12.0 to 1.

Elections have been outlawed. Crime is a problem, possibly because it is difficult to make it through a day without breaking one of the country's many regulations. Master Bantu's national animal is the deer, which can occasionally be seen sifting through garbage in the nation's cities.
